The Sattur Chamber of Commerce and Industry has urged for nationalisation of all rivers in the country. In a letter addressed to Prime Minister Dr Manmohan Singh, suggesting measures for consideration in the ensuing budget, chamber secretary, Mr P. T. K. A. Balasubramanian, said nationalisation is necessary to boost production of foodgrains and solve drinking water problem in the country. The suggestions, include installation of solar cells with announcement of a subsidy in all homes, industries and business places, drilling of new oil wells in East and West coastline, lowering of tax rates on petrol by State and Union Government and desist from levy of cess on agricultural goods by State governments.
